The Postgraduate Certificate in Project Communication and Quality Management is a specialized program designed to equip students with the skills and knowledge required to excel in project communication and quality management.
This program is ideal for professionals working in project management, construction, IT, and other industries where effective communication and quality management are crucial.
Upon completion of the program, students can expect to gain a deeper understanding of project communication and quality management principles, including stakeholder engagement, risk management, and quality assurance.
The learning outcomes of this program include the ability to develop and implement effective communication strategies, manage project risks, and ensure quality standards are met.
The duration of the program varies depending on the institution and the mode of study, but it typically takes one to two years to complete.
The Postgraduate Certificate in Project Communication and Quality Management is highly relevant to the construction industry, where effective communication and quality management are critical to project success.
The program is also relevant to the IT industry, where project communication and quality management are essential for delivering high-quality software products on time and within budget.
